The Web is a Marketing Platform
Feb 11, 2007The Web is a marketers paradise. A community of connected individuals talking, reading, publishing, collaborating, syndicating, discovering, and sharing information around the world and around the clock. A community where every individual participates by contritbuting content, tags, links, descriptions, comments, bookmarks, and opinions.
So when we came across this video on You Tube last week, we figured there was no better way to kick off the new Salesforce Marketing blog:
Web 2.0 ... The Machine is Us/ing Us
The video is itself informative, describing the changes that are at the very heart of the web and the internet marketing revolution. Even more interesting is the manner in which this information is disseminated. The format is video, published for free on You Tube. Over the course of 10 days, the community has viewed the video 806,077 times, posted 2749 comments, and republished the video or the link on countless other websites and blogs (such as this one) that resyndicate the content via RSS.
To take it a step further, search engines crawl the web and index its content and links. As of the date of this post, the video ranks #4 out of 164,000,000 search results for the term "web 2.0 video" ...and it all happened in a matter of days
It really makes you think. If your prospects and your customers are online, how are you reaching them? How are you disseminating your message and interacting with your community?
